PostgreSQL, postgisインストール
PostgreSQLが複数バージョンあったので、適切なのが依存で入るだろと思った
sudo port install postgis
postgresql83 geos bison ossp-uuid projがいっしょに入った。
これ入ってなかった
sudo port install postgresql83-server
自動起動させる
sudo launchctl load -w /Library/LaunchDaemons/org.macports.postgresql83-server.plist
作業領域確保
sudo mkdir -p /opt/local/var/db/postgresql83/defaultdb sudo chown postgres:postgres /opt/local/var/db/postgresql83/defaultdb sudo su postgres -c '/opt/local/lib/postgresql83/bin/initdb -D /opt/local/var/db/postgresql83/defaultdb'
Success. You can now start the database server using: /opt/local/lib/postgresql83/bin/postgres -D /opt/local/var/db/postgresql83/defaultdb or /opt/local/lib/postgresql83/bin/pg_ctl -D /opt/local/var/db/postgresql83/defaultdb -l logfile start
とのこと
rubyからも使いたい
sudo gem install postgis_adapter GeoRuby
pgadminインストールしておく
http://www.postgresql.org/ftp/pgadmin3/release/v1.8.4/osx/